I went to the Andover-Newton library today to obtain a copy of Henry Ware, Jr.’s famous essay on the connection (or, as he writes, “connexion”) between the pulpit and the pastoral role. After the library assistant handed me the ancient book and I flipped through it, I realized to my great and hysterical delight that it contained the entire pamphlet war between Andrews Norton and George Ripley following Emerson’s Divinity School Address of 1838!!!

I have been wanting to read those slap-downs for YEARS and as of next week, after the library copies the pages for me, I can.

I’m sure some of you wonks out there will tell me that I could have found all these documents in some really accessible place, like on the coffee table in the Harvard Div School Library or something, but I don’t want to hear it. pooh.
